Treatment Overview
Penile PRP Injections, commonly known as the P‑Shot, are a regenerative therapy designed to enhance male sexual function, performance, and penile health. This treatment uses the patient’s own blood, processed to concentrate platelets rich in growth factors, which are then injected into penile tissue. The PRP stimulates tissue regeneration, improves blood flow, enhances nerve sensitivity, and promotes vascular health. The therapy is minimally invasive and can address erectile dysfunction, reduced sensitivity, and decreased sexual stamina. Possible Risks & Complications
The P‑Shot is generally safe, as it uses the patient’s own blood. Minor risks may include:
- Mild pain, swelling, or redness at the injection site
- Temporary bruising or tenderness
- Rare infection if hygiene protocols are not strictly followed
- Slight bleeding or tingling at the injection area
- Temporary numbness or discomfort
Side effects are usually mild and resolve within a few days. Experienced Korean specialists further reduce the risk of complications.
Techniques & Technology Used
Korean clinics employ advanced techniques to ensure effective results:
- Blood Collection & PRP Preparation: Patient’s blood is processed to concentrate platelet-rich plasma.
- Targeted PRP Injections: PRP is injected into specific areas of the penile tissue to enhance regeneration, vascularization, and nerve sensitivity.
- Imaging Guidance (if needed): Ultrasound or Doppler imaging ensures precise PRP placement.
- Adjunct Therapies: Some clinics combine the P‑Shot with shockwave therapy, vacuum devices, or hormone optimization for enhanced outcomes.
These methods maximize regenerative effects and sexual health improvements.
Treatment Process in Korea
The typical process includes:
- Consultation & Assessment: Comprehensive evaluation of sexual function, penile tissue quality, and medical history.
- Blood Collection & PRP Preparation: Blood is drawn and processed to isolate concentrated platelets.
- PRP Injection: Targeted microinjections are administered to penile tissue to enhance function and performance.
- Follow-Up: Patients are monitored for improvements in erectile function, sensitivity, stamina, and overall sexual health. Booster sessions may be recommended for optimal results.
Each session typically lasts 45–60 minutes. Multiple sessions may be advised depending on individual needs.
Recovery & After-Care
Recovery is generally fast and uncomplicated:
- Avoid sexual activity for 3–5 days post-treatment
- Mild swelling, redness, or tenderness may occur at injection sites
- Avoid strenuous activity for 1–2 days
- Maintain a healthy lifestyle to support tissue regeneration
- Follow-up visits are recommended to monitor progress and schedule booster sessions if needed
Patients can usually resume normal daily activities shortly after the procedure.
